Search courses 👉
Professional Training

PHP and MySQL Introduction

Future Savvy, In London (+4 locations)
Length
2 days
Next course start
Enquire for more information (+5 start dates)
Course delivery
Classroom, Virtual Classroom
Length
2 days
Next course start
Enquire for more information (+5 start dates)
Course delivery
Classroom, Virtual Classroom
Leave your details so the provider can get in touch

Course description

PHP and MySQL Introduction

MySQL™ and PHP are two of the most popular open-source technologies to emerge during the past decade. PHP is a powerful language for writing server-side Web applications. MySQL is the world's most popular open-source database. Together, these two technologies provide you with a powerful platform for building database-driven Web applications.

This Introduction to PHP training course examines the core concepts and technologies required to build a basic dynamic website using PHP. The Introduction to PHP training begins by examining how to setup and configure Apache to support PHP and then our Introduction to PHP training moves on to explore the language fundamentals of PHP. The Introduction to PHP training concludes with a discussion about form-driven websites, state management, and overall site design.

Upcoming start dates

Choose between 5 start dates

Enquire for more information

  • Classroom
  • Birmingham

Enquire for more information

  • Classroom
  • London

Enquire for more information

  • Classroom
  • Manchester

Enquire for more information

  • Classroom
  • Reading

Enquire for more information

  • Virtual Classroom
  • Online

Suitability - Who should attend?

Prerequisites

This course is suitable for experienced web developers with a good grasp of HTML and general web concepts.

Training Course Content

Getting started

  • Background to PHP
  • Installation and configuration
  • Embedding PHP tags
  • Adding comments
  • Using the Print function

PHP scripting

  • Using variables
  • Dynamic variables
  • Data types
  • Defining arrays
  • Associative arrays
  • Manipulating arrays
  • Operators and expressions
  • If statements
  • Switch statements
  • The While statement
  • The For statement
  • Defining functions
  • Passing arguments

Working with forms

  • Forms overview
  • Capturing user input
  • Get and Post differences
  • Working with global variables
  • Handling file uploads

Accessing databases

  • Establishing a connection
  • Setting up queries
  • Using SQL commands
  • Displaying results
  • Adding records
  • Modifying records
  • Deleting records

State management

  • Overview of strategies
  • Using hidden fields
  • Creating query strings
  • Reading and setting cookies
  • Setting expiry dates
  • Deleting cookies
  • Overview of session functions
  • Using session variables
  • Tracking the session ID
  • Manipulating data
  • Formatting strings
  • Manipulating strings
  • Searching strings
  • Regular expression functions
  • Replacing patterns in strings
  • Splitting strings
  • Formatting dates
  • Converting data types

Errors and debugging

  • Overview of PHP errors
  • Logging errors
  • Typical scripting errors
  • Debugging strategies
  • Using Print statements
  • The Debug function

Request info

Contact form

Fill out your details to find out more about PHP and MySQL Introduction.

  Contact the provider

  Get more information

  Register your interest

Country *

reCAPTCHA logo This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.
Future Savvy

Welcome to Future Savvy, your gateway to a world of boundless learning and professional growth! At Future Savvy, we believe that knowledge is the key to success, and we are dedicated to providing top-notch training solutions designed to empower individuals...

Read more and show all courses with this provider

Ads